UDFs and UDTFs — Question 3
Use the database TASTY_BYTES. Create a user-defined table function called menu_prices_below using the CREATE FUNCTION command. Have it take in an argument called price_ceiling of type NUMBER. Have it return TABLE (item VARCHAR, price NUMBER), and make the contents of the function the following: SELECT MENU_ITEM_NAME, SALE_PRICE_USD FROM TASTY_BYTES.RAW_POS.MENU WHERE SALE_PRICE_USD < price_ceiling ORDER BY 2 DESC When you run SELECT * FROM TABLE(menu_prices_below(3)); what is the item you see repeated multiple times in Results?
This exercise is part of the course
Intro to Snowflake for Devs, Data Scientists, Data Engineers
Hands-on interactive exercise
Turn theory into action with one of our interactive exercises
Start Exercise